日本大地震及海啸的早期预测及临震信号

摘要
2011年3月11日日本发生了9级大地震,引发10~23.6 m的大海啸,造成核电站泄漏,损失惨重.震中位于北纬38.1度,东经142.6度.早在2008年7月25日,北京工业大学地震研究所根据5种异常信号作出"关于日本大地震及海啸预测".实际发生的地震正好在预测的区域范围之内,而且确实发生了高达10 m的破坏性海啸.并且在这次大地震前,北京工业大学地震研究所还记录到5种前兆异常信号.这表明一个7级以上的地震有一个能量积累的过程,往往在震前几年就会出现前兆异常信息,尤其在震前几天还会陆续出现临震前兆异常,抓住这些信息对实现地震的预测预防极为重要.
Japan was hit by a massive 9.0-magnitude earthquake that triggered a tsunami 10-23.6 m high and leakiness of nuclear power on March 11,2011.This earthquake caused very heavy loss.The 9.0-magnitude epicenter has been located 38.1° N,142.6° E.As early as July 25,2008,Institute of Earthquake Prediction of Beijing University of Technology had made an internal earthquake prediction(Prediction of Strong Earthquake and Tsunami in Japan) based on five different types of precursor anomalies appearing at that time.Actual earthquake was just within the region of the prediction,and truly caused devastating Tsunami with a height of 10 m.Before the earthquake,five types of precursory signals were received.This shows that an earthquake above 7-magnitude is formed a energy accumulation process,and a few years ago some precursory information appear.Imminent anomalies will appear in succession a few days before earthquakes.Capturing this information for earthquake prediction prevention is very important.
